BIGGERS, Earl Derr. The Chinese Parrot. Indianapolis: The Bobbs-Merrill Company, 1926. With dust jacket. -- Behind That Curtain. Indianapolis: The Bobbs-Merrill Company, 1928. -- The Black Camel. Indianapolis: The Bobbs-Merrill Company, 1929. With dust jacket. -- Charlie Chan Carries On. Indianapolis: The Bobbs-Merrill Company, 1930. With dust jacket. -- Another copy (without jacket). -- Keeper of the Keys. Indianapolis: The Bobbs-Merrill Company, 1932. With dust jacket. -- Another copy (with jacket). Together 7 volumes, all FIRST EDITIONS, 8o, original cloth, FIVE WITH DUST JACKETS, condition varies.
[With:] BIGGERS, Earl Derr. Four "Better Little Books" editions with black-and-white comic strips by Alfred Andriola: Inspector Charlie of the Honolulu Police (two copies), Inspector Charlie Chan Solves a New Mystery and Inspector Charlie Chan, Villainy on the High Seas. Racine, Wis.: Whitman Publishing Company, 1939-1942. Thick 12o. Original pictorial boards. -- ANDRIOLA, Alfred. Charlie Chan. Papeete-Tahiti: Comic Stars of the World, 1976. 2 volumes, oblong folio. Black-and-white comic strip (vol. I) and color comic strip (vol. II). Original decorated boards. -- BIGGERS and ANDRIOLA. Charlie Chan Vol. 3 [wrapper title]. Long Beach, Calif.: Tony Raiola, n.d. Oblong folio. Black-and-white comic strip. Original yellow decorated wrappers. -- Another copy. -- Quotations from Charlie Chan. New York: Golden Press, 1968. 8o. Wrappers. -- Another copy. -- COHAN, George M. Seven Keys to Baldpate. New York: Samuel French, 1914. 8o. Frontispiece and plates. Original wrappers. Dramatized version of Biggers's novel. -- Charlie Chan Mystery Magazine. Vol. I, nos. 1, 3 and 4. Los Angeles: Renown Books, Nov. 1973, May and Aug. 1974. 3 volumes, 8o. Illustrations in text. Original wrappers. -- HANKE, Ken. Charlie Chan at the Movies. History, Filmography, and Criticism. Jefferson, NC and London: McFarland, 1989. 8o. Original cloth. -- PENZLER, Otto. Earl Derr Biggers' Charlie Chan. New York: Mysterious Bookshop, 1999. 8o. Wrappers. Signed by Penzler. (23)
